Output 2c8126c281f9e42fbbee7af7e073e90713d5f02066a86f311fd7ecdf9a864dc0:0

value
6222473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11d4ad54f805031ab6f86a9d15abc119488b984e OP_EQUAL
address
33KJBsFq5z3kpiHh2VM8HsbW2RwPvaBDkd
transaction
2c8126c281f9e42fbbee7af7e073e90713d5f02066a86f311fd7ecdf9a864dc0
spent
true